Note: On Windows, where a long double is the same as a double, nextafterl is the same as nextafter, nexttowardl is the same as nexttoward. Also nexttoward is the same as nextafter.

#include "libm.h"
|
|
|
|
float nexttowardf(float x, long double y)
|
|
{
|
|
union {float f; uint32_t i;} ux = {x};
|
|
uint32_t e;
|
|
|
|
if (_isnan(x) || _isnan(y))
|
|
return x + y;
|
|
if (x == y)
|
|
return y;
|
|
if (x == 0) {
|
|
ux.i = 1;
|
|
if (signbit(y))
|
|
ux.i |= 0x80000000;
|
|
} else if (x < y) {
|
|
if (signbit(x))
|
|
ux.i--;
|
|
else
|
|
ux.i++;
|
|
} else {
|
|
if (signbit(x))
|
|
ux.i++;
|
|
else
|
|
ux.i--;
|
|
}
|
|
e = ux.i & 0x7f800000;
|
|
/* raise overflow if ux.f is infinite and x is finite */
|
|
if (e == 0x7f800000)
|
|
FORCE_EVAL(x+x);
|
|
/* raise underflow if ux.f is subnormal or zero */
|
|
if (e == 0)
|
|
FORCE_EVAL(x*x + ux.f*ux.f);
|
|
return ux.f;
|
|
}
